Abstract :
This paper proposed a new scheme to generate a real-time paper time scale by utilizing the ensemble clock data and the two-way satellite time and frequency transfer (TWSTFT) data among the laboratories in the Asia-Pacific region. By integrating above data, with specific weighting methodology and using fuzzy prediction, this research can form a reference time scale to analyze the time difference with local UTC in real-time. The proposed scheme is investigated by conducting a three-month long fuzzy predictor which based on the calculated clock ensembles from TWSTFT links among Asian timing laboratories. The performance is accredited with respect to time scale of the UTC(TL), as well as UTC.
